Импликация - это что такое? Импликация в логике: определение и примеры

Импликация - непростое логическое понятие, которое часто путают с обычным "если... то...". На самом деле, это гораздо более интересный и многогранный логический инструмент, используемый в доказательствах и выводах. Давайте разберемся, что же она из себя представляет.

Определение импликации

Импликация - это логическая связка в форме "если A, то B", где A - посылка, а B - заключение. Она обозначается стрелкой A → B или символами ⊃, ⇒. Импликация позволяет связывать простые высказывания в сложные и использовать одно высказывание в качестве обоснования другого.

Импликация - это логический союз, который выражает зависимость между объектами, когда наличие одного объекта или признака влечет за собой наличие другого объекта или признака" - другими словами, это условное утверждение "если есть A, то есть B".

Девушка читает книгу про логику импликаций на лугу в солнечный день

Таблица истинности для импликации:

A B A → B
0 0 1
0 1 1
1 0 0
1 1 1

Как видно, импликация ложна только в одном случае: когда посылка A истинна, а заключение B ложно. Во всех остальных случаях импликация истинна.

Импликация и логическое следование

Часто понятия "импликация" и "логическое следование" отождествляют. Но на самом деле, это разные вещи.

Импликация A→B - это логическое выражение, которое само по себе может быть истинным или ложным в зависимости от истинности A и B.

А логическое следование A ⇒ B означает, что B обязательно истинно, если A истинно. Это утверждение само по себе не может быть ни истинным, ни ложным - оно или выполняется, или не выполняется.

Например, утверждение "Если число четное, то оно делится на 2" - это импликация. А утверждение "Из того, что число четное, следует, что оно делится на 2" - это логическое следование.

Профессор у доски сосредоточенно пишет уравнения с импликациями

Роль импликации в рассуждениях

Импликация играет важную роль в логических рассуждениях и доказательствах. С ее помощью можно выразить причинно-следственные связи, сформулировать гипотезы, теоремы, научные законы.

Например, закон Ома в электротехнике формулируется через импликацию:

Если на участке цепи сопротивлением R течет электрический ток силой I, то на концах этого участка возникает разность потенциалов (напряжение) U, равная произведению силы тока на сопротивление: U = RI.

Здесь "если... то..." выражает причинно-следственную связь между физическими величинами.

Другой пример - использование импликации при доказательстве от противного:

  • Доказывается некое утверждение A.
  • Предполагается, что утверждение A ложно (т.е. истинно отрицание ¬A).
  • Из ¬A логически следует некое ложное утверждение B.
  • Значит, изначальное предположение ¬A было неверно.
  • Следовательно, исходное утверждение A истинно.

Видим, что импликация ¬A → B играет ключевую роль в этом рассуждении.

Так что без импликаций не обойтись ни в математических доказательствах, ни при построении гипотез или формулировке научных законов. Это важнейший логический инструмент.

Разновидности импликаций и их особенности

Существует несколько разновидностей импликаций, отличающихся друг от друга своими свойствами:

  • Материальная импликация - самый распространенный в классической логике вид, определяемый стандартной таблицей истинности.
  • Строгая импликация утверждает, что заключение B необходимо вытекает из посылки A.
  • Релевантная (уместная) импликация предполагает наличие смысловой связи между A и B.

Таким образом, в зависимости от контекста и решаемой задачи может использоваться та или иная разновидность импликации в "логике".

Что такое импликация в языках программирования

Хотя импликация чаще ассоциируется с математической "логикой", она также широко используется и в языках программирования.

В частности, условные инструкции if-then в языках программирования по сути являются разновидностью импликации.

Например, на Python код:

if x > 0: print("Число положительное") 

выражает импликацию: если x > 0 (посылка), то выводится сообщение "Число положительное" (заключение).

Импликация в повседневных рассуждениях: примеры

Примеры импликации можно найти и в обычных разговорах или текстах на естественных языках типа русского или английского. Хотя здесь она зачастую выражается неявно при помощи союзов "если..., то...".

Например:

  • Если на улице дождь, то я возьму зонтик.
  • Если ты не будешь мешать мне спать, то я не стану на тебя ругаться.

Однако в отличие от математической "логики", в обыденной речи импликации не всегда строго выполняются. Люди нередко говорят "если..., то..." из вежливости или шутки, без реального намерения следовать этой связи.

История возникновения термина

Само слово "импликация" произошло от латинского implicatio, означающего "сплетение, связывание". Уже в работах Аристотеля встречается идея выражения сложных суждений через связывание простых суждений с помощью "если..., то...".

А термин "импликация" в современном значении, по-видимому, впервые использовал Готфрид Лейбниц в 17-м веке в своих работах по логике. В дальнейшем это понятие получило строгое формальное определение в математической "логике".

Роль импликации в современной логике

Несмотря на долгую историю, понятие импликации продолжает играть важную роль в современной логике и науке.

В частности, импликация широко используется при формулировке научных гипотез и законов. Многие естественнонаучные законы имеют форму импликации - "если на систему воздействовать определенным образом, то возникает такой-то эффект".

Кроме того, импликация входит в состав большинства формальных логических систем, используемых в качестве языка науки - начиная с исчисления высказываний и заканчивая различными разделами математической логики.

Открытые вопросы изучения импликации

Несмотря на кажущуюся простоту, до сих пор остаются открытые вопросы в понимании и изучении импликации.

В частности, ведутся дискуссии о том, какая именно разновидность импликации наиболее адекватно отражает реальные причинно-следственные связи - материальная, строгая, релевантная или какая-то другая.

Также не до конца ясно, как человеческий мозг обрабатывает импликативные высказывания типа "если..., то..." на естественных языках вроде русского или английского. Этот вопрос интересует психологов и нейробиологов.

Подведем итоги

Итак, мы разобрали основные аспекты импликации как важного понятия в логике, программировании и научном мышлении. Увидели разные трактовки, примеры использования импликации в рассуждениях и ее роль во всей истории науки.

Надеюсь, теперь у вас сложилось целостное представление о том, что такое импликация, где и как она применяется. И теперь это понятие не будет казаться чем-то таинственным или запутанным!

Статья закончилась. Вопросы остались?
Комментарии 0
Подписаться
Я хочу получать
Правила публикации
Редактирование комментария возможно в течении пяти минут после его создания, либо до момента появления ответа на данный комментарий.